It was a nice surprise to realize the hostel is on the riverfront. It's a nice riverfront district, not far from the metro. The breakfast included cereal, bread, jam, juice, and coffee, and was pretty good, especially eaten while looking at the river. Rooms were large and clean, with sturdy lockers. There were a few areas people could hangout. Besides the bar, there was an area with computers and tables, where I joined in on some conversations. Overall, a very nice place.

Stayed there for two nights, and it was a very nice hostel. The beds in the dorms are very nice they include a curtain, light and two outlets which are very convenient. The hostel also has a very nice atmosphere for those who are younger. However, the prices at the bar are pretty expensive (then again, it is Paris). I\'d also recommend bringing your own towel when staying here, as a towel will set you back 10 euro. None the less, it was a very nice hostel and I\'d definitely come back!

90%

I had heard that there were no decent hostels in Paris, but St. Christopher's definitely disproves this statement. Good facilities, comfortable rooms, great security, large lockers (you need a large padlock to lock them though or a cable lock), and a decent location close to a couple metro stations with staff very willing to explain how to get anywhere and what to see... but all with a slightly overpriced price tag, just like everything else in Paris.
